Choosing Ground Beef for Crispy Coffee-Spiced Beef Tacos

A moderately fatty ground beef works best for this recipe because it keeps the meat juicy while allowing the edges to crisp properly. Leaner blends can dry out quickly during skillet cooking, especially when forming the crust that gives these tacos their signature texture.

Fresh vegetables mixed directly into the meat also contribute moisture and flavor. Finely diced onions soften during cooking while jalapeños add gentle heat throughout the filling. Green bell pepper introduces sweetness that balances the smoky spices beautifully.

Why Marinating Improves Crispy Coffee-Spiced Beef Tacos

Allowing the beef mixture to rest in the refrigerator for several hours makes a noticeable difference. The spices have time to distribute evenly while the aromatics settle into the meat completely. Overnight marination develops even more flavor and helps the coffee integrate smoothly into the filling.

This resting period also improves texture. The baking powder gently tenderizes the mixture, helping the meat brown beautifully while remaining juicy inside.

Getting a Golden Crust on Crispy Coffee-Spiced Beef Tacos

The crust is where much of the flavor develops. Pressing the meat firmly onto a hot skillet encourages direct contact with the cooking surface, creating dark caramelized edges that deliver incredible texture. Patience matters here. Allowing the meat to cook undisturbed for several minutes creates the best browning.

Once the tortilla is pressed onto the beef, the juices soak into the corn tortilla while the underside continues crisping. That dual-texture effect creates tacos that taste both crunchy and rich at the same time.

Crispy Taco Shells With Cast-Iron Cooking

Cast iron retains heat exceptionally well, making it ideal for crispy tacos recipe techniques. A properly heated skillet ensures even browning while helping the tortilla become golden without turning dry or brittle.

Corn tortillas work especially well because they crisp quickly and hold their structure once folded. Pressing the folded taco gently after adding cheese creates even more crunch around the edges while sealing the melted cheese inside.

Crispy Coffee-Spiced Beef Tacos


  • Author: Mia Martinez
  • Total Time: 2 hours 40 minutes
  • Yield: 8 tacos

Description

Bold crispy tacos filled with smoky coffee-spiced beef, melted cheese, and crunchy corn tortillas.


Ingredients

2 pounds ground beef

1 medium white onion, finely diced

3 jalapeño peppers, finely chopped

1 small green bell pepper, finely chopped

2 tablespoons minced garlic

2 tablespoons instant coffee or finely ground coffee

1 tablespoon beef bouillon powder

1 tablespoon black pepper

1/2 teaspoon ground cardamom

3/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g

3/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on

1 1/2 teaspoons smoked paprika

1 tablespoon baking powder

Corn tortillas

Shredded cheddar cheese, Monterey Jack, or Mexican cheese blend

Favorite taco sauce or creamy sauce

Fresh cilantro, chopped


Instructions

1. Finely dice the onion, jalapeños, and green bell pepper.

2. Mince the garlic cloves finely.

3. Combine the beef, vegetables, coffee, bouillon powder, black pepper, cardamom, nutmeg, cinnamon, smoked paprika, and baking powder.

4. Mix thoroughly until evenly combined.

5.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ight.

6. Preheat a c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at.

7. Place a portion of beef mixture onto the skillet and spread slightly.

8. Cook undisturbed until a dark crust forms.

9. Press a corn tortilla directly onto the beef.

10. Flip the tortilla and beef together carefully.

11. Cook until the tortilla becomes crisp and golden.

12. Sprinkle cheese over the beef and allow it to melt.

13. Fold the tortilla into taco shape and press gently.

14. Top with sauce and cilantro before serving hot.

Notes

For deeper flavor, marinate the beef overnight.

Cast-iron skillets create the crispiest texture.

Serve immediately for the best crunch.
